Key Parameters
- RF Coaxial
- Conductor:sliver plated Copper Apply
- 44AWG*208 core
- Impedance:85Ω
- Capacitance:50pF/M
- Signal Wire
- N/A
- Diameter:7.6mm
- Jacket Material:PVC (white)
- Application:Ultrasound Transducer Probe Assembly
